In the cutthroat world of football talent acquisition, Manchester United and Liverpool are locked in a fierce battle for Lille’s 18-year-old defensive gem, Leny Yoro. Dubbed “one of the best talents in the world” by Fabrizio Romano, the sought-after prodigy has also attracted interest from powerhouses like Real Madrid and PSG.
“Leny Yoro could be a name to watch for the summer. The talented young Lille centre-back is now represented by Jorge Mendes, one of the best agents in the world.
And Yoro is really one of the best talents in the world, he really is a fantastic centre-back.
For Lille, the idea is to keep the player until the end of the season, because they feel in the summer there is going to be a big fight between top clubs to sign Yoro.
Real Madrid have been in attendance multiple times to watch Yoro – they really like this boy, so let’s see if they will be in the race this summer.
For sure they are scouting the player, and also the new people in charge at Manchester United, with INEOS having an excellent relationship with Jorge Mendes.

Journalist Fabrice Hawkins spilled the beans, revealing an official approach from Manchester United. Meanwhile, Liverpool, as reported earlier, is ‘drooling’ over Yoro, eager to shape his future.
With Yoro’s contract expiring in 2025, Lille anticipates a bidding war this summer. The price tag dance ranges from €80-90 million (£69-78 million) this month to €50-60 million (£43-52 million) in the summer.
Standing at 6ft 3, Yoro, with 39 Lille appearances and four France Under-21 caps, is poised to be the next football sensation. Henry said in November, via Le10Sport,
“What he is doing is extraordinary. Another young player who is having good matches. Warren Zaire-Emery attracts a little more attention by being at PSG, playing in the Champions League, he has just joined the A.
But it’s true that Leny is doing a huge job at the moment.”
According to Thierry Henry, Yoro’s extraordinary talent is destined for greatness, potentially gracing the ranks of Manchester United or Liverpool. The summer transfer saga unfolds, with Lille holding the cards for a lucrative deal.
